How to backup mongodb every night - it's really easy.

  Рет қаралды 25,856

Mafia Codes

Mafia Codes

3 жыл бұрын

In this video you will learn how to backup #mongodb every night. We won't be using any third-party packages but will do everything on our own, but only for scheduling we will use a package called #node-cron.
For backup we would be using #Nodejs #child-process #spawn method to do backup using the #mongodump command.
Deploy apps: zeet.co/r/yourstruly
(One FREE project forever 😘)
Github: github.com/trulymittal/mongod...
FREE $100 credit @Digital Ocean: m.do.co/c/3208f08b3324
Subscribe: kzfaq.info...
Support the channel:
Paypal: www.paypal.me/trulymittal
Patreon: / trulymittal
⭐ Kite is a free AI-powered coding assistant that will help you code faster and smarter. The Kite plugin integrates with all the top editors and IDEs to give you smart completions and documentation while you’re typing. I've been using Kite for 6 months and I love it! www.kite.com/get-kite/?...
---------------
Other useful Playlists
---------------
#RestAPI (#NodeJS and MongoDB): • REST API using NodeJS ...
#API Authentication using #JWT: • NodeJS API Authenticat...
#Firebase: • Firebase | Build a Not...
Docker: • Docker
MongoDB: • Learn MongoDB in 50 mi...
Html/Css/Js: • HTML / CSS / JS
Android: • Android
Challenges: • Challenges
#yoursTRULY #tutorial #howto #nodejs #android

Пікірлер: 33
@aakashgautam2200
@aakashgautam2200 3 жыл бұрын
good example of child process cron and mongodump beautifully blended.
@kouroshtajallie1366
@kouroshtajallie1366 3 жыл бұрын
best tutorial i saw this year so far
@mafiacodes
@mafiacodes 3 жыл бұрын
Wow, thanks!
@KnifeInTheSnow
@KnifeInTheSnow Жыл бұрын
fantastic tutorial, easy to understand
@leamonlee8809
@leamonlee8809 2 жыл бұрын
Awesome! Thanks for sharing.
@gokul_sreejith
@gokul_sreejith 2 жыл бұрын
Thank you so much very useful 💟
@kailaashjeevanj6434
@kailaashjeevanj6434 2 жыл бұрын
Thank you so much 💕
@adelghaeinianphantomphood
@adelghaeinianphantomphood Жыл бұрын
Thank you so much sir.
@MrBay-z5m
@MrBay-z5m 3 күн бұрын
Awesome my friend
@sudeshchaudhary4558
@sudeshchaudhary4558 2 жыл бұрын
Awesome!
@nidhikalra4122
@nidhikalra4122 Жыл бұрын
Getting error "mongodump : The term 'mongodump'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again."
@DeepanshuMalviyaPhysics
@DeepanshuMalviyaPhysics 2 жыл бұрын
will this backup the whole collection or just the new documents added.......and if it creates the backup of whole collection every time is it not inefficient !
@neerajverma9226
@neerajverma9226 3 жыл бұрын
Please make video on Cassandra database its one of the popular nosql database
@emirsalihovic6616
@emirsalihovic6616 2 жыл бұрын
Sir, what theme are you using?
@khwbhawjfamilylivechannel322
@khwbhawjfamilylivechannel322 3 жыл бұрын
Hi sir, after I backUp like this video, and I world like to push to git by using child_proccess, How can I do? Do you have toturial?
@marzukzarir
@marzukzarir Жыл бұрын
Great
@jibinjn
@jibinjn 6 ай бұрын
how can i do this in google cloud app engine ? now i am getting error mongodump not found, locally working fine
@ProgrammingWithOsku
@ProgrammingWithOsku 2 жыл бұрын
Do you know that you are the best
@sumitmathur8596
@sumitmathur8596 3 жыл бұрын
sir please tell me how to delete backup after some time .
@AdamSuchiHafizullah
@AdamSuchiHafizullah 3 жыл бұрын
Nice tutorial sir. But maybe --db is deprecated. When i run mongorestore your suggest code, its return error "The --db and --collection flags are deprecated for this use-case; please use --nsInclude instead, i.e. with --nsInclude=${DATABASE}.${COLLECTION}"
@bryanltobing
@bryanltobing 3 жыл бұрын
so how you fix that?
@williamsantos382
@williamsantos382 2 жыл бұрын
Put the nsInclude= before the db= tag
@aakashgautam2200
@aakashgautam2200 3 жыл бұрын
how can i decide when to use exec or spawn or fork specifically ? please address it .
@mafiacodes
@mafiacodes 3 жыл бұрын
watch this video and u'll get to know what to use when kzfaq.info/get/bejne/mMidedl0x7yooaM.html
@sunilvurandur7415
@sunilvurandur7415 3 жыл бұрын
does it support a huge data? like 3-5GB in a .gzip file..
@mafiacodes
@mafiacodes 3 жыл бұрын
yup I guess so, it will...
@nimajavanmardi4768
@nimajavanmardi4768 2 жыл бұрын
spawn mongodump ENOENT i get this error
@Lerogorn
@Lerogorn Жыл бұрын
You need to add the folder with mongodump.exe to "path" in environment variables in your OS
@riteshthakur9250
@riteshthakur9250 3 жыл бұрын
my database is in mongo cluster it's not offline or local it's online so how can i do it.
@mafiacodes
@mafiacodes 3 жыл бұрын
mongodump takes in a lot of arguments and u can easily add them in the spawn function, have a look for args @ docs.mongodb.com/database-tools/mongodump/#bin.mongodump
@rupakmagar6680
@rupakmagar6680 2 жыл бұрын
did u find any solution? I am stuck at this.
@natikirstdami7224
@natikirstdami7224 3 жыл бұрын
2:32 I like that😍💋 💝💖❤️
Setup MongoDB for Production deployment - Replica Sets cluster
19:42
That's how money comes into our family
00:14
Mamasoboliha
Рет қаралды 9 МЛН
I Can't Believe We Did This...
00:38
Stokes Twins
Рет қаралды 93 МЛН
THE POLICE TAKES ME! feat @PANDAGIRLOFFICIAL #shorts
00:31
PANDA BOI
Рет қаралды 24 МЛН
Solid State Batteries are Closer Than You Think
15:08
Undecided with Matt Ferrell
Рет қаралды 626 М.
How to create a child process in nodejs (exec, execFile and spawn)
13:39
Migrate Docker Volumes from one Host to another // backup and restore
8:56
Learn how to do caching in NodeJS using Redis
24:34
Mafia Codes
Рет қаралды 33 М.
Understanding Fork Bombs in 5 Minutes or Less
5:55
Engineer Man
Рет қаралды 167 М.
RDS Backup/Restore with AWS Backup Service
15:57
Infinite Linux
Рет қаралды 10 М.
#255 Node-Red, InfluxDB, and Grafana Tutorial on a Raspberry Pi
16:31
Andreas Spiess
Рет қаралды 252 М.
That's how money comes into our family
00:14
Mamasoboliha
Рет қаралды 9 МЛН